#f41484 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f41484 is composed of 95.7% red, 7.8%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.8% magenta, 45.9%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 330 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 51.8%. #f41484 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ff28ff with #e90009. Closest websafe color is: #ff0099.

Shades and Tints of #f41484
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090005 is the darkest color, while #fff5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#f41484
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c7c84 is the less saturated color, while #fd0b84 is the most saturated one.
